建安风骨 建安風骨 jiàn'ān​fēng​gǔ
Jian'an style
The literary and poetic style characteristic of the Jian'an era (196-220 AD) of the Eastern Han Dynasty, marked by a combination of vigorous health and directness with themes of social unrest and sorrow; primarily associated with the Cao family poets and the 建安七子 jiàn'ān​qī​zǐ
